ControlExtensions.AddComboBox Yöntem (ControlCollection, Double, Double, Double, Double, String)
Yeni bir ekler ComboBox çalışma sayfasında belirtilen boyutunu ve konumunu denetlemek.
Ad alanı: Microsoft.Office.Tools.Excel
Derleme: Microsoft.Office.Tools.Excel.v4.0.Utilities (Microsoft.Office.Tools.Excel.v4.0.Utilities.dll içinde)
Sözdizimi
'Bildirim
<ExtensionAttribute> _
Public Shared Function AddComboBox ( _
controls As ControlCollection, _
left As Double, _
top As Double, _
width As Double, _
height As Double, _
name As String _
) As ComboBox
public static ComboBox AddComboBox(
this ControlCollection controls,
double left,
double top,
double width,
double height,
string name
)
Parametreler
- controls
Tür: Microsoft.Office.Tools.Excel.ControlCollection
Denetim eklemek için koleksiyon.Bu parametre kendinizin saðlamasý değil.Tarafından döndürülen koleksiyonu bu yöntem aradığınızda Worksheet.Controls (uygulama düzeyinde projedeki) özelliği veya WorksheetBase.Controls özelliği (bir belge düzeyinde projesinde), bu parametre otomatik olarak sağlanır.
- left
Tür: System.Double
Nokta denetiminin sol kenarına çalışma sayfasının sol kenarı arasındaki uzaklık.
- top
Tür: System.Double
Nokta denetim üst kenarını çalışma sayfasının üst kenarı arasındaki uzaklık.
- width
Tür: System.Double
Puan denetimin genişliği.
- height
Tür: System.Double
Denetim noktaları yüksekliği.
- name
Tür: System.String
Denetimin adı.
Dönüş Değeri
Tür: Microsoft.Office.Tools.Excel.Controls.ComboBox
ComboBox Eklenmiştir Denetim ControlCollection örneği.
Kullanım Notu
Visual Basic ve C# programlarında, bu yöntemi ControlCollection türündeki herhangi bir nesne üzerinde örnek yöntemi olarak çağırabilirsiniz. Bu yöntemi çağırmak için örnek yöntemi sözdizimini kullandığınızda, ilk parametreyi yok sayın. Daha fazla bilgi için bkz. Uzantı Yöntemleri (Visual Basic) veya Genişletme Yöntemleri (C# Programlama Kılavuzu).
Özel Durumlar
Exception | Koşul |
---|---|
ArgumentNullException | Ad bağımsız değişkeni nullnull başvuru (Visual Basic'te Nothing) veya sıfır uzunlukta. |
ControlNameAlreadyExistsException | Aynı ada sahip bir denetim içinde ControlCollection örneği. |
Notlar
AddComboBox Yöntemi eklemenize olanak sağlayan ComboBox sonuna kadar nesne ControlCollection.Kaldırmak için bir ComboBox önceden programlı olarak eklenmiş olan denetim ve Remove yöntemi.
Örnekler
Aşağıdaki kod örneği ekler bir ComboBox kontrol çalışma sayfasının en üstüne, iki öğe için birleşik giriş kutusu ekler ve ilk öğeyi seçer.Çalıştır buradan bu örneği kullanmak için Sheet1 bir belge düzeyinde proje sınıfında.
Private Sub ExcelAddComboBox()
Dim ComboBox1 As Microsoft.Office.Tools.Excel. _
Controls.ComboBox = Me.Controls.AddComboBox( _
0, 0, 90.75, 15.75, "ComboBox1")
ComboBox1.Items.Add("First Item")
ComboBox1.Items.Add("Second Item")
ComboBox1.SelectedIndex = 0
End Sub
private void ExcelAddComboBox()
{
Microsoft.Office.Tools.Excel.Controls.ComboBox
comboBox1 = this.Controls.AddComboBox(0, 0,
90.75, 15.75, "comboBox1");
comboBox1.Items.Add("First Item");
comboBox1.Items.Add("Second Item");
comboBox1.SelectedIndex = 0;
}
.NET Framework Güvenliği
- Anında arayanlar için tam güven. Bu üye kısmen güvenilen kodla kullanılamaz. Daha fazla bilgi için bkz. Kısmen Güvenilen Koddan Kitaplıkları Kullanma.